Mexican Mountain Papaya Fruit plant (Jacaratia mexicana) Plant type:Seedling Plant Light: Aglaonema 'Boxing' thrives inCommon Name: Bonete, Mexican Mountain Papaya Botanical Name: Jacaratia Mexicana General Information: Deciduous shrub or small tree growing from 5 12 meters tall, with occasional specimens growing taller. Native to dry areas in Southern Mexico and into Central America. Fantastic, wild, dry forest papaya bearing strongly winged obovoid 4 15 cm long fruits.
